one. Introduction to URL Shortening
URL shortening is a method online where a lengthy URL is often transformed right into a shorter, more workable sort. This shortened URL redirects to the original long URL when frequented. Companies like Bitly and TinyURL are well-recognized samples of URL shorteners. The need for URL shortening arose with the appearance of social media marketing platforms like Twitter, where character restrictions for posts created it difficult to share very long URLs.

Over and above social websites, URL shorteners are valuable in advertising campaigns, e-mail, and printed media exactly where extensive URLs can be cumbersome.

2. Core Components of a URL Shortener
A URL shortener commonly contains the subsequent parts:

World wide web Interface: This is the front-close component in which customers can enter their prolonged URLs and get shortened versions. It may be an easy sort on the Website.
Database: A database is necessary to store the mapping concerning the first prolonged URL along with the shortened Edition. Databases like MySQL, PostgreSQL, or NoSQL choices like MongoDB can be used.
Redirection Logic: This is the backend logic that can take the limited URL and redirects the user towards the corresponding extensive URL. This logic is generally applied in the web server or an software layer.
API: Quite a few URL shorteners supply an API in order that third-bash programs can programmatically shorten URLs and retrieve the original prolonged URLs.
three. Planning the URL Shortening Algorithm
The crux of a URL shortener lies in its algorithm for converting a protracted URL into a brief a single. Many techniques might be utilized, for example:

Hashing: The very long URL might be hashed into a hard and fast-dimension string, which serves as being the shorter URL. However, hash collisions (distinct URLs resulting in exactly the same hash) must be managed.
Base62 Encoding: One particular popular tactic is to utilize Base62 encoding (which uses sixty two characters: 0-nine, A-Z, and also a-z) on an integer ID. The ID corresponds for the entry while in the database. This technique makes sure that the small URL is as brief as is possible.
Random String Technology: An additional approach would be to produce a random string of a fixed duration (e.g., 6 figures) and Check out if it’s now in use during the database. Otherwise, it’s assigned on the extended URL.
4. Database Administration
The databases schema for your URL shortener is generally straightforward, with two Principal fields:

ID: A unique identifier for every URL entry.
Lengthy URL: The original URL that needs to be shortened.
Shorter URL/Slug: The limited Model with the URL, frequently saved as a novel string.
In combination with these, you should keep metadata like the development date, expiration day, and the quantity of instances the short URL has been accessed.

five. Managing Redirection
Redirection is really a critical Portion of the URL shortener's operation. Each time a user clicks on a short URL, the support ought to quickly retrieve the original URL in the database and redirect the consumer utilizing an HTTP 301 (long lasting redirect) or 302 (short-term redirect) standing code.

Overall performance is essential here, as the procedure must be almost instantaneous. Approaches like database indexing and caching (e.g., employing Redis or Memcached) can be utilized to hurry up the retrieval procedure.

6. Stability Concerns
Protection is a significant problem in URL shorteners:

Destructive URLs: A URL shortener can be abused to spread malicious inbound links. Implementing URL validation, blacklisting, or integrating with third-occasion stability providers to check URLs in advance of shortening them can mitigate this risk.
Spam Prevention: Charge restricting and CAPTCHA can reduce abuse by spammers trying to create 1000s of shorter URLs.
seven. Scalability
As the URL shortener grows, it may need to take care of many URLs and redirect requests. This demands a scalable architecture, probably involving load balancers, dispersed databases, and microservices.

Load Balancing: Distribute visitors across several servers to deal with substantial masses.
Distributed Databases: Use databases that could scale horizontally, like Cassandra or MongoDB.
Microservices: Independent considerations like URL shortening, analytics, and redirection into distinct providers to further improve scalability and maintainability.
8. Analytics
URL shorteners typically deliver analytics to trace how often a short URL is clicked, exactly where the site visitors is coming from, together with other valuable metrics. This calls for logging Each and every redirect and possibly integrating with analytics platforms.
